Department Housing & Residence Life Compensation $15.00 Hourly General Description / Primary Purpose Work performing housekeeping duties including cleaning rest rooms, lounges, student apartments, common use areas, and carpet and tile floors. This position requires a positive, self-motivated person with excellent interpersonal skills, willing to work in an environment requiring strong emphasis on providing superior customer service in conformance with the Universitys mission and values. Housing and Residence Life are an integral part of the Division of Student Affairs, and as such, is measured by its ability to successfully interact with students and to assist in their individual needs and concerns. To this end, the Custodial Worker will often be required to demonstrate a caring and patient attitude, utilize conflict resolution skills, and to ensure that every effort is made to create satisfied students. Job Functions Cleans and maintains floors Completely vacuums floors daily; Spray buffs resilient tile floors to maintain good, clean, and gloss appearance; Strips and re-waxes resilient tile floors to maintain appearance; Shampoos carpets as needed; Uses pile brush vacuum to lift carpet pile to prolong life and maintain appearance; Clean grout on ceramic tile floors; Use extractors to remove moisture Cleans and maintains lounges Completely vacuums floors daily; Empties wastebaskets daily; Spot cleans walls, floors, and doors as needed; Reports problems due to damage or wear to supervisor; Reports non-functioning light bulbs; Arranges furniture in proper order; Shampoos upholstered furniture when soiled; Wipe down tables and chairs Cleans and maintains public lounge appliances Thoroughly cleans and checks microwaves for proper operation; Thoroughly cleans and checks stoves for proper operation as needed; Empties wastebaskets daily; Reports problems due to malfunctions, damage, or wear to supervisor; Reports non- functioning appliance lights; Cleans sinks, counter tops, cabinets and vent hoods to remove food, grease and soil Cleans and maintains halls, common areas, postal facility, stairwells, courtyards, parking areas, elevators and building entrance areas, and ground areas Vacuums floors and upholstered furniture daily; Dusts tables, window sills, arms and legs of chairs, fire extinguisher and water hose cabinets, and the like, daily; Damp cleans vinyl-covered furniture daily; Shampoos upholstered chairs when soiled; Sweeps exposed stairway and steps daily; Sweeps and/or mops tile floors daily; Cleans drinking fountains daily; Cleans stairway handrails as needed; Spot cleans walls and doors as needed; Cleans elevator doors, cabins and door tracks as needed; Removes debris from and sweeps entrance walks and steps daily; Keeps entrance mats clean and presentable; Empties trash containers and sand urns daily; Reports non-functioning light bulbs to supervisor; Reports burnt out light bulbs; Pressure washes external concrete areas as required; Properly disposes of contaminated trash and waste materials. Cleans and maintains rooms, apartments and suites Removes debris, sweeps, and vacuums as assigned; Spot cleans walls, floors, and doors as needed; Cleans, defrosts and deodorizes refrigerator as needed; Thoroughly cleans and checks stove for proper operation as needed; Cleans sinks, countertops, cabinets, and vent hood to remove food, grease and soil; Properly cleans, sanitizes and disinfects all fixtures, walls, floors, mirrors, and shelves; Vacuums and cleans air conditioner closets; Shampoos carpets as needed Cleans glass windows, doors, and window blinds Uses proper cleaners to remove grime, smudges, or other substances from glass surfaces; Thoroughly cleans surfaces leaving no streaks or the residue; Uses proper equipment and takes all safety precautions when cleaning hard to reach glass surfaces; Cleans glass as needed or when directed by supervisor; e) cleans window blinds as assigned All other duties as assigned Required Qualifications Completion of ninth (9th) grade or an equivalent combination of education and experience pursuant to Fla. It reflects UNFs mission to contribute to the public good and prepare educated, engaged citizens. The University of North Florida is a public university in Jacksonville, Florida. Located between Jacksonvilles beaches and downtown, UNF is set on a beautiful 1,381-acre campus surrounded by nature. Focused on student success, UNF has an annual enrollment of about 17,000 and graduates more than 4,000 students each year. The University offers small class sizes and individualized attention, strong job placement, a welcoming environment and active student life, and is known for providing students with transformational learning experiences research with faculty, community-based learning or studying abroad, which UNF students do at twice the national average. UNF has more than 200 student clubs and organizations as well as 19 athletic teams and participates in Division I of the NCAA. UNF consistently ranks high for quality and value, and is recognized nationally by U.S. News & World Report as a Top Public institution. The University holds the prestigious Community Engagement Classification from the Carnegie Foundation, a designation held by only 5% of universities in the U.S., and numerous other distinguished rankings. A member institution of the State University System of Florida, UNF is accredited by the Southern Association of Colleges and Schools Commission on Colleges to award baccalaureate, master's and doctoral degrees.
